The Accenture Regulatory Compliance Platform (ARCP) offers integrated responsive technology, agile methodologies and processes and scalable shared services to help deliver cost efficiencies and support growth.
ARCP comes with four components to support a strong, high functioning compliance solution that meets today’s and tomorrow’s compliance needs. Components include:
Global technology platform: The ARCP becomes a one-stop shop for all compliance activities, and lets clients assess compliance efforts through its full set of analytics. |
Shared services: Low-value tasks can be managed by BPO staff. Meanwhile, highly specialized functions can be performed by well-trained data scientists and legal specialists as needed. |
Technology support: Clients can offload support responsibility to a 24/6 help desk that provides technology help. |
Continuous improvement: Periodic assessments identify changes needed to address evolving regulatory requirements, as well as industry trends. |
